Microbiome
The trillions of microbes—including bacteria, viruses, fungi, and single-celled archaea—that live on and in all of us.
Psychobiotics
Also referred to as "mood microbes," these are groups of researchers' proposed treatments that use microbes to improve mental health.
Germ-free mice
Mice used in scientific studies that have never come into contact with microbes and have a completely sterile upbringing.
Vagus nerve
An information superhighway that acts as one of the routes connecting the brain and the gut.
Short-chain fatty acids
Chemicals produced when bacteria break down fiber in the diet, which can have effects throughout the body.
microRNAs
Tiny strips of genetic code used by gut bugs that may alter how DNA works in nerve cells.
Diversity
A rule of thumb for a healthy microbiome, referring to a wide variety of different species living all over the body.
Human genome
The full set of genetic instructions for a human being, made up of 20,000 instructions called genes.
Second genome
A term for the microbiome, which contains between 2 million and 20 million microbial genes.
Trans-poo-sion
A term used within the scientific community for the process of transplanting the microbiome from one subject to another animal.
Anhedonia
A feature of depression involving the loss of interest in activities that are normally found pleasurable.
Motor symptoms
Physical symptoms, such as the characteristic tremor in Parkinson's disease, which appear to be driven or caused by changes in the microbiome.
Personalised medicine
The future of medical practice where a patient's microbiome is assessed alongside other standard health tests like cholesterol.
Human cell percentage
The finding that if you count all the cells in your body, only 43% are human; the rest constitute the microbiome.
